Mikumi's sprawling landscapes and vibrant wildlife rival the famed Serengeti Plains. Here, the 'Big Five' – cheetah, lion, elephant, buffalo, and rhino – call home. Unique to Mikumi, you might even spot lions scaling trees, a sight rarer elsewhere.
Ruaha River's flow carves a path through this sanctuary, housing a thriving population of African elephants and nearly 10% of Africa's lions. Be ready to capture captivating snapshots of these majestic creatures.
Encounter kudu, sable, and roan antelopes, unique to Ruaha. Spot leopards, cheetahs, and giraffes amidst zebras, elands, impalas, and more. Your journey might even unveil the elusive wild dogs of Ruaha.
Selous beckons with tranquility amidst the wild. Traverse the sprawling Rufiji River, encounter the Stiegler Gorge, and immerse yourself in this haven of undisturbed safari experiences. Venture on a walking safari with an armed ranger, a rarity found here.
